Richard Casino is the one operator that spells out what its 40x applies to: the bonus amount alone. The other four don't publish the wagering base in the terms we reviewed, which matters because 40x on deposit plus bonus is double the turnover of 40x on the bonus by itself.
What actually makes a site a slot site
A slot site, in the sense people search for it, is a casino lobby built around pokies first. Reel and video machines fill most of the front page, with table games and live dealer tables sitting in a side menu rather than leading the homepage. That's different from a full-scale casino that gives pokies, sports betting and live tables equal billing.
All five operators here open on a pokies grid, then tuck sports or live sections behind a tab. That's the pattern worth checking for if you're comparing a site that isn't on this list.
Real money pokies and the PayID rail
Real money play means a deposit that lands in your balance in minutes, not a demo credit. Since June 2024, credit card deposits have been blocked across Australian-facing casino sites, so the fastest local rail is PayID and its instant-payment network Osko: money moves bank to bank without a card number attached.
CrownPokies also lists Visa, Mastercard, Neosurf, bank transfer, Bitcoin, Ethereum and Tether at its cashier, so if you already hold crypto that's a deposit route without a card at all. We couldn't confirm which methods the other four operators run because their cashiers didn't load on the day we checked. If PayID matters to you, verify it's live on the deposit page before you register, not after.

Picking the best pokies site for you
A few checks take less time than a first deposit and save more than they cost:
- Confirm PayID or Osko shows up at the cashier before you register, not after.
- Read whether the wagering multiplier applies to the bonus alone or to deposit plus bonus. The difference doubles what you need to turn over.
- Note the max bet cap while a bonus is active. Betting over it usually voids the whole balance, not just the excess.
- Check the free spins expiry. Both Tuesday spins offers here need a fresh code each week and don't roll over.
- If you're depositing at VIP level, ask support for the wagering figure directly since it isn't published in the terms for either high roller pack on this page.
